I had a Make-it-work-moment when I made this card. I saw this technique on Piterest using a doilie as a mask making pretty patterns. Well, I was a bit underwhelmed by the results of my first try. But when the doilies dried they looked super pretty! I used the doilies to cover up the failed background and was happy as a clam. Don't know why a clam should be happier than other creatures but I guess they are. Well, to make a long story shorter, I was super happy with the soft color of this card. I love all the pastel tones I see around the web but for some reason my cards gets a lot brighter and more saturated. I actually used the papers from the Stitched collection by Amy Tan as a guide for what watercolors I would use. Why don't I do that more often. I always color everything first, and then try to find papers that match, which I never do and end up using no patterned papers instead. Will do this again.
